Was okay - It was basically a great day in the desert. Quad ride costs extra. The dune bashing and sandboarding were great. However, it was extremely long driving and waiting times, as hundreds of different providers offer the same tour and all want to go to the places at the same time. The camp was felt more of a tourist rip-off, constantly some traders came and wanted to turn you on something that was extremely annoying and you had to buy a VIP pass for better seats. The food was good. Free drinks were only available in the camp, at the quad spot you would have had to buy something. The tours are unfortunately more mass tourism.
